About

Experience the world's elite off-road motorcycle riders as they compete for the 2024 Monster Energy AMA Supercross Championship. Witness the intense on-track action in person over the course of a 17-round season in which riders face off on some of the nation’s most technically-demanding tracks. Watch elite riders like Cooper Webb, Justin Cooper and Eli Tomac race across tight corners and fast straightaways as they compete for Chase Sexton’s 450SX Class title. In the 250SX Class, riders will compete for the East or West Series titles held by the dominant brother duo of Jett and Hunter Lawrence.

FAQS

The 2024 Monster Energy AMA Supercross Championship season begins on January 6 in Anaheim, California and concludes in Salt Lake City, Utah on May 11.

Standard individual tickets will be available through Ticketmaster and each venue’s box office. Group tickets are available in select markets. Please check local venues for availability.

The 2024 Monster Energy AMA Supercross Championship travels across the U.S. in the following cities: 

  • Round 1 – 01/06 – Anaheim, CA @ Angel Stadium 
  • Round 2 – 01/13 – San Francisco, CA @ Oracle Park
  • Round 3 – 01/20 – San Diego, CA @ Snapdragon Stadium
  • Round 4 – 01/27 – Anaheim, CA @ Angel Stadium 
  • Round 5 – 02/03 – Detroit, MI @ Ford Field 
  • Round 6 – 02/10 – Glendale, AZ @ State Farm Stadium
  • Round 7 – 02/24 – Arlington, TX @ AT&T Stadium
  • Round 8 – 03/02 – Daytona Beach, FL @ Daytona International Speedway
  • Round 9 – 03/09 – Birmingham, AL @ Protective Stadium
  • Round 10 – 03/16 – Indianapolis, IN @ Lucas Oil Stadium
  • Round 11 – 03/23 – Seattle, WA @ Lumen Field
  • Round 12 – 03/30 – St. Louis, MO @ The Dome at America’s Center
  • Round 13 – 04/13 – Foxborough, MA @ Gillette Stadium 
  • Round 14 – 04/20 – Nashville, TN @ Nissan Stadium 
  • Round 15 – 04/27 – Philadelphia, PA @ Lincoln Financial Field 
  • Round 16 – 05/04 – Denver, CO @ Empower Field at Mile High
  • Round 17 – 05/11 – Salt Lake City, UT @ Rice-Eccles Stadium 

Monster Energy AMA Supercross Championship events usually begin early in the evening before rider introductions, practice laps and qualifying. Each event is similar in length to other professional sporting events. 

You can extend the excitement by attending your city’s FanFest.

The Monster Energy AMA Supercross Championship FanFest is a pre-race event that provides access to the world’s elite riders as they prepare, practice and qualify for that day’s races! Fans can meet their favorite riders, see bikes up close, and watch exclusive entertainment before each Monster Energy AMA Supercross Championship race. 

*All fans ages two and up must have a ticket to attend FanFest. FanFest activities vary by location. FanFest locations depend on the city and venue. Please check local venues for exact details.

Monster Energy AMA Supercross Championship is a fun event for people of all ages. In most venues, children under two are admitted free provided they sit on a parent or guardian's lap. Children ages two and up will require tickets for all events, including FanFest and VIP Experiences. Public event laws vary nationwide and from county to county, and some venues may require all patrons, regardless of age, to have a ticket. 

*Please check with your local venue to confirm their specific policy.
